This means the successful candidate is expected to report to Springhill on a full-time basis.The role:The Material Industrial Engineer is an integral part to daily and future Global Supply Chain (GSC) operations. The Material Industrial Engineer will lead Lean Material Strategies (LMS) initiatives at Spring Hill GPS and serve as the Subject Matter Expert (SME) for daily and future material automation applications.Work is of a technical nature and focused on making complex manufacturing processes more efficient, which involves understanding the systematic cross functionality of several departments, including engine machining, engine assembly, and Global Supply Chain. Significant use of independent judgment is required, as well as the ability to think critically and creatively to solve problems and drive projects forward.The Material Industrial Engineer will lead and support complex supply chain projects, particularly material automation projects, that involve collaboration between several in-plant departments, Headquarters engineering organizations, UAW team members, and third-party suppliers and contractors. Exceptional communication and relationship building skills are essential for success in this role.What you'll do:Automation Projects:Lead the scoping, planning, and execution of large-scale material automation projects that drive reductions to labor costs and/or increases to operational efficienciesCollaborate with Headquarters engineering groups to develop business cases, Statements of Work (SOW), and Statements of Requirement (SOR) for new cost saving projects, particularly material automation projects and projects that support LMSAnalyze data used for simulations to evaluate material automation feasibility and capabilityBuild systems to ensure safe and efficient human interaction with material automationAnalyze labor utilizations and implement job rebalances using GMOS, STDS, and APSPartner with engineering, operations, and other organizations to design new material packaging, gravity flow racks, dollies, and material staging stands to ensure designs meet quality, safety, ergonomic, and throughput requirementsSupport the configuration of automation workflows with robotic cells, other material automation vendors, and material pull systemsStrategize interim-state installation plans to ensure production targets are metParticipate in safety buyoff processes, including g-Risks and g-Comply, for new equipment and automationTravel to equipment suppliers as needed to support the runoff (equipment specification testing) processPartner with several stakeholder groups to support the automation installation process, including Start of Regular Production (SORP)Support large-scale production projects that involve the introduction of robotic cells, cobots, and other automated assembly line equipment as neededMaterial Automation Operations:Program and make logic and systematic changes to a fleet of automated mobile equipment from multiple vendorsContinuously improve material delivery routes for automation and driversLeverage data to provide root cause analysis for complex material automation faults and inefficienciesDrive Throughput Improvement Process (TIP) improvements for a fleet of automated mobile equipment using data analyticsServe as a Subject Matter Expert (SME) for, train, and provide guidance to a team of UAW material automation attendantsStandardize material automation fault recovery strategies and Preventative Maintenance (PM) tasksEstablish material automation sustainment strategies, including spare parts planning, coordinating software updates, and coordinating supplier technician supportGSC Operations:Continuously improve dock, material staging, and warehouse layouts and operationsAnalyze existing operations and drive continuous improvements (CI) to processes and jobs with collaboration from UAW team membersLead and support Operational Excellence projectsMonitor adherence to recommended Safety procedures and ergonomics guidelinesYour Skills and Abilities (Required Qualifications):Bachelor's degree in engineering, supply chain, or a related degree, or equivalent experience2+ years of work or educational experience in data analytics2+ years of work or educational experience in automation, robotics, or general programming1+ years of work or educational experience in supply chain1+ years of work or educational experience in human factors (time studies, ergonomics, human-computer interaction, etc.)High level of interpersonal skillsHigh level of communication and project management skillsDemonstrated ability to analyze and solve complex problemsExperience leading large and difficult projects with a high level of autonomyAbility to work off-shift, weekends, or overtime to support project implementations or to make material automation programming changesWhat will give you a competitive edge (Preferred Qualifications):2+ years of manufacturing experienceProficiency in material automation programmingProficiency in understanding material automation lidar, camera, safety, and localization systemsProficiency in AutoCAD or other computer-aided drafting and layout toolsExperience working in a unionized manufacturing environmentLean Six Sigma Green Belt certificationCompensation:The expected base compensation for this role is: 77,500.00 - 121,600.00 USD Annual.
